PER CURIAM:
Two towing vessels owned by the defendants, Continental Oil Company and Dixie Carriers, Inc., collided with each other and with a bridge that the plaintiff, Boh Bros. Construction Co., was in the process of building for the state of Louisiana. The defendants stipulated as to their liability and the trial concerned only the question of damages.
